Licensing and Regulatory Oversight
When you type “is rainbet legit” into a search box, the first thing you’ll probably check is the licence. Rainbet operates under a licence issued by the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), one of the most respected regulators in the world of online gambling. The MGA requires operators to keep player funds in separate accounts, undergo regular audits and adhere to strict anti‑money‑laundering rules.
For Australian players, the MGA licence also means that the site must respect the Australian Consumer Law when it comes to fair play and dispute resolution. While the MGA does not prohibit Australian residents from playing, you should still confirm that the operator accepts players from Australia on its terms and conditions page.
Security and Data Protection
Security is another pillar of legitimacy. Rainbet uses 128‑bit SSL encryption for all data transfers, the same technology banks use for online banking. Your personal details and payment information are stored on secure servers that are regularly scanned for vulnerabilities.
In addition, the platform employs two‑factor authentication (2FA) for withdrawals, which adds a layer of protection against unauthorised access. If you ever suspect suspicious activity, the support team can lock your account while they investigate.
Registration and Verification Process
Signing up at Rainbet is straightforward: you provide a name, email, date of birth and create a password. After you confirm the email, the platform will ask for a few identity documents – typically a driver’s licence, passport or utility bill – to satisfy KYC (Know Your Customer) requirements.
The verification usually takes between a few hours to 24 hours. For most Australian users, the process is painless, but keep a digital copy of your ID handy to avoid delays, especially if you plan to claim a welcome bonus quickly.
Bonuses, Promotions and Wagering Requirements
Rainbet markets an attractive welcome package that includes a match bonus on your first deposit plus a bundle of free spins. The exact amount can vary, but the typical offer is a 100% match up to AU$500 and 50 free spins on selected slots.
All bonuses come with wagering requirements – usually 30× the bonus amount – which you need to clear before you can withdraw any winnings generated from the bonus. To help you calculate, here’s a quick example:
- Deposit AU$100, receive AU$100 bonus.
- Wagering requirement: 30 × AU$100 = AU$3,000.
- If you bet on a 96% RTP slot, you’ll need to play roughly 31 rounds of a AU$100 stake to meet the requirement.

Payment Methods and Withdrawal Speed
Australian punters have a decent range of deposit options at Rainbet, from credit/debit cards to popular e‑wallets. Below is a snapshot of the most common methods and how fast they usually move money.
| Method | Deposit Speed | Withdrawal Speed | Typical Fees |
|---|---|---|---|
| Visa / Mastercard | Instant | 2‑5 business days | None |
| PayPal | Instant | 1‑2 business days | None |
| POLi (AU bank transfer) | Instant | 1‑3 business days | None |
| Bank Wire (local AU) | Same day | 3‑7 business days | AU$5‑10 |
Withdrawals are processed on a “first‑in‑first‑out” basis – the older the request, the quicker it gets handled. Most players report that PayPal and POLi are the fastest ways to get cash into their bank accounts.
Mobile App, Live Casino and Sportsbook Experience
Rainbet offers a responsive mobile website that works well on both Android and iOS devices. The layout mirrors the desktop version, giving you access to slots, table games, live dealer tables and the full sportsbook.
If you prefer a dedicated app, it’s available through the Google Play Store and the Apple App Store. The app loads games faster, sends push notifications about new promotions, and supports instant deposits via saved payment methods.
Live casino fans will find professional dealers, real‑time streaming and a decent selection of blackjack, roulette and baccarat. The sportsbook covers Australian rules football, cricket, NRL, and major international leagues, with competitive odds and the occasional “instant payout” market.
Customer Support and Responsible Gambling
Good support is a hallmark of a legit operator. Rainbet provides 24/7 live chat, email support (support@rainbet.com) and a telephone hotline that rings during Australian business hours. Response times in chat are usually under two minutes, and agents speak Australian English with a friendly tone.
Responsible gambling tools are built into the account dashboard: you can set deposit limits, loss limits, session timeouts and even self‑exclude for a period of up to six months. The site also links to Australian gambling help organisations such as Gambling Help Online.
